While San Francisco restaurants await the Obama administration's stance on the Healthy SF lawsuit, the Appeal notices a hilarious exchange in the LAT between Zazie owner Jennifer Piallat and a customer who was offended by the $1 surcharge: "Though her customers have largely taken it in stride, one woman demanded an audience so she could say how 'truly offended' she was 'that I have to pay a dollar to subsidize your employees' healthcare' .... Piallat's response? 'While we're being honest, I'm offended that you're wearing a 4-carat diamond and complaining about a dollar.'" [SFA/LAT]
